4000 Ex-Mayor - Built 1925 - GEORGE. T. Tuby - Survived
Alderman George Tuby was a famous Yorkshire showman and he ordered 7 brand new engines from Burrell over the years. They were all painted in the dark blue of the Great Eastern Railway. They were probably the finest fleet of Showmans engines. She was delivered in 1925 after being exhibited at the Lynn Mart Fair. The Scenic ride she was to power had been sold to Pat Collins so she never carried the auxiliary dynamo. She was saved by her showland driver Frank Cheffin who bought her from Tuby. Later owned by Michael Lane who wrote the definitive book on Burrell Showmans Road locomotives. Now owned by the Saunders Collection.
